Chair of the maritime and admiralty practice at Winston & Strawn LLP, Charlie Papavizas is nationally recognized in major legal directories. Chambers USA ranks him as the only “Star Individual” in the category of “Transportation: Shipping/Maritime: Regulatory,” who is “the Dean of the maritime bar” and “the godfather of maritime law.” He is widely known for his experience with Jones Act laws and the U.S. offshore wind industry.
Charlie focuses his practice on administrative, legislative, and finance matters, primarily in the maritime industry generally and the U.S. offshore wind industry in particular. He has been actively engaged in the U.S. offshore wind sector since 2009 and counsels numerous clients working in various aspects of the industry, including obtaining the first Jones Act offshore wind-related ruling in 2010.
Charlie is frequently consulted on the application of U.S.-flag laws and regulations, particularly the application of U.S. coastwise laws (“Jones Act”) to cargo, passenger, and vessel movements and investments in U.S. companies.
He has extensive experience in advocacy on behalf of maritime clients before various federal agencies, including the U.S. Coast Guard, the U.S. Maritime Administration, and the U.S. Congress. Such clients have included U.S. and foreign vessel owners and operators, industrial companies, private equity firms, commercial banks, and other financial institutions, shipyards, ship managers, and marine equipment suppliers.
His book, Journey to the Jones Act: U.S. Merchant Marine Policy 1776-1920, was published in 2024.
